Pediatric critical care in hospitals has evolved from single all-purpose intensive care units (ICUs) to multiple specialized units that care specifically for neonatal, pediatric, cardiac, and technology-dependent patients or combinations of these. Ideally, the pediatric cardiac critical care nurse should possess basic knowledge about the anatomy and pathophysiology of the common congenital heart diseases, the surgical treatment for the disease, cardiopulmonary bypass and its effects on organ systems, hemodynamic monitoring of cardiac patients, essentials of pace makers and cardiac pacing .
